随着区块链技术的迅猛发展,比特币在数字货币市场中的地位愈发重要。与此同时,基于比特币的智能合约技术也逐渐受到越来越多人的关注。智能合约是一种自执行的合约,其条款直接写入代码中,并在区块链上运行。这种技术为比特币的应用提供了更多的可能性,其中智能合约钱包则成为用户进行交易、持有和管理比特币的重要工具。

在这篇文章中,我们将深入探讨比特币智能合约钱包的种类与功能,同时解答一些相关问题,让大家对这一主题有更全面的了解。

什么是比特币智能合约钱包?

比特币智能合约钱包是一种能够支持比特币智能合约的数字钱包。与传统钱包只能进行基本的比特币存储和交易不同,智能合约钱包可以执行合同中的代码,从而实现更复杂的功能。例如,用户可以通过智能合约钱包创建自动化交易、托管服务、预言机服务等。

比特币智能合约实际上是通过多重签名和时间锁等技术实现的。一旦合同条件被满足,智能合约将自动执行,确保交易的安全性和透明性。

比特币智能合约钱包的主要类型

比特币智能合约钱包的推荐及其功能解析

1. **硬件钱包**:硬件钱包是存储数字资产的一种设备,能够安全地管理私钥。对于智能合约功能,硬件钱包通常与其他软件进行集成,以实现签署和执行合约。

2. **软件钱包**:软件钱包是应用程序或平台的形式,用户可以直接在手机或电脑上使用。它们的优点是易于访问和使用,但安全性相对较低。

3. **在线钱包**:在线钱包是基于云服务的平台,用户可以在任何地方通过互联网访问。虽然方便,但用户需要对提供钱包服务的网站有足够的信任。

4. **多签钱包**:多签钱包支持多个私钥共同控制一个钱包的资产。这样的设计增加了安全性,因为任何支出都需要多个签名。这对智能合约的实现也至关重要,特别是在涉及多个参与方的合约时。

如何选择合适的比特币智能合约钱包?

选择合适的比特币智能合约钱包时,用户需考虑几个关键因素:

1. **安全性**:钱包必须具备高水平的安全性,包括加密技术、双重认证等功能。

2. **易用性**:用户界面应,使用户能够快速上手。

3. **功能丰富性**:钱包应支持多种类型的智能合约,满足用户的多样化需求。

4. **社区与支持**:选择一个活跃的社区和技术支持,可以帮助解决潜在的问题。

比特币智能合约钱包的未来发展趋势

比特币智能合约钱包的推荐及其功能解析

随着区块链技术的不断进步,比特币智能合约钱包的未来发展潜力巨大。例如,随着去中心化金融(DeFi)的崛起,智能合约钱包有望与更多金融工具和服务结合,拓展其应用场景。

此外,安全性和隐私保护将成为钱包开发的重要方向。随着用户对安全性的关注增加,钱包提供商需不断其安全特性,从而赢得用户的信任。

比特币智能合约钱包存在的挑战

尽管比特币智能合约钱包有诸多优点,但也面临一些挑战:

1. **技术复杂性**:智能合约的编写和执行需要一定的编程知识,普通用户可能难以掌握。

2. **安全漏洞**:如果智能合约被编写得不当,可能会出现安全漏洞,导致资产损失。

3. **法律监管**:各国对智能合约的法律地位尚未明晰,可能影响用户的使用体验。

总结

比特币智能合约钱包为用户提供了更为灵活和安全的数字资产管理方式。本文讨论了它的定义、类型、选择因素、未来发展以及面临的挑战。希望能为希望使用或了解比特币智能合约的用户提供一些有价值的信息。

相关问题及解答

1. 如何确保比特币智能合约的安全性?

在数字货币领域,安全性始终是用户最关心的问题之一。确保比特币智能合约的安全性有几个方面:

首先,合约代码的审计至关重要。许多成功的智能合约项目都经过第三方的审计,以发现可能的漏洞和弱点。用户在使用某个钱包前,可以查找该钱包背后是否有经过验证的安全审计历史。

其次,选择知名度高、社区活跃的智能合约钱包。在这样的生态系统中,用户更容易获得技术支持,同时也能参考其他用户的使用经验,规避潜在的风险。

最后,用户必须保持自身的安全习惯。例如,定期更新软件、使用强密码、开启双重认证等都是保护数字资产的重要措施。

2. 比特币智能合约与以太坊智能合约有什么不同?

比特币和以太坊两个平台的智能合约本质上是实现类似目标的不同技术实现。比特币的智能合约相对简单,主要通过多重签名和时间锁等基础功能来实现条件执行。而以太坊则提供了更为复杂的编程环境,实现了一系列功能丰富的DApps和智能合约。

以太坊的智能合约可以拥有更复杂的逻辑、自定义功能,甚至支持整个去中心化金融体系(DeFi)的构建。而与之相比,比特币的智能合约在复杂性和灵活性上有所欠缺。

不过,比特币的优势在于它的安全性和去中心化:由于比特币经过了多年的验证和广泛的使用,其整体网络的安全性和稳定性相比于任何新兴的平台都更有保障。

3. 使用比特币智能合约钱包需要技术基础吗?

虽然智能合约本质上是由代码驱动的,但许多比特币智能合约钱包设计得相对友好,普通用户也可以轻松上手。然而,对于希望深入理解和修改智能合约的人来说,具备一定的技术基础无疑会有所帮助。

用户通常只需要了解如何创建地址、发送和接收比特币,以及如何利用钱包的智能合约功能进行操作。对于更复杂的自动化交易或托管合约,用户可能需要一些编程知识。

总的来说,使用智能合约钱包不一定需要深厚的技术功底,但了解一些基本概念会使用户的体验更加顺畅。

4. 目前市场上有哪些流行的比特币智能合约钱包?

市场上有许多流行的比特币智能合约钱包,每个钱包都具有各自独特的功能与特点。以下是一些推荐钱包:

  • **Electrum**:一个轻量级的比特币钱包,支持多种智能合约功能,用户界面友好。
  • **Armory**:相对较为复杂的选择,提供多重签名和高级安全设置,适合对安全性要求较高的用户。
  • **Wasabi Wallet**:一款注重隐私保护的钱包,支持比特币的智能合约。
  • **Coldcard**:硬件钱包,支持比特币智能合约,旨在提供最高的安全性。

5. 用户如何有效管理其比特币智能合约?

有效管理比特币智能合约的关键在于监控和执行。用户应定期检查其所拥有的智能合约的执行情况,了解是否有条件未满足或合约未成功执行的情况。另外,了解合约的所有条款和条件充分了解风险非常重要。

用户还应当妥善保管其私钥,使用具有双重认证特性的钱包来增加安全性。同时,保持对市场动态的关注也能帮助用户及时调整其合约策略,以应对市场变化。

总之,用户在使用比特币智能合约钱包时,需保持警觉,定期评估合约的表现,确保资产的安全与合约的有效执行。

以上就是关于比特币智能合约钱包的详细介绍及相关问题解析,希望对您有所帮助。通过以上内容,您应该能够更加深入了解比特币智能合约钱包的功能以及如何选择和使用。